Overview

Crafted from antiqued-brass toned metal, the Hines I is a unique, nautically inspired pendant light that resembles a marine passageway lamp. An antiqued brass metal cage protects the 40-Watt rated, standard E26 bulb used in the Hines I and adds to the visuals of the lamp. Suspended using an adjustable chain measuring 60 inches in length, the Hines I fits perfectly in spaces based on the Industrial or Mercana Modern design styles.

Features

  • 8.0" High Pendant Light: The Hines measures 4.0" long by 4.0" wide by 8.0" high. 
  • Premium Composition: The Hines is expertly crafted from metal components that ensure sturdiness and stability. 
  • Superior Finish: Featuring a conical shade finished in an antiqued-brass polish, the Hines is a posh lighting fixture that boasts of a superior polish guaranteed to add a touch of panache to any space and setting.  
  • Modern/Industrial Inspired Design: Designed to be an instant head-turner in modern or industrial spaces, the Hines I flaunts clean lines and a unique design that is complemented by its radiant finish. 
  • Easy Assembly: This pendant light follows an easy assembly process which means it is ready to turn heads in your space shortly after it arrives at your doorstep.
